Bruce could let caretaker manager Brum

November 13 2001

Steve Bruce

Steve Bruce

A report in today's Independent states that Birmingham City could let Steve Bruce choose a caretaker manager to take charge until he is allowed to take up the post himself.

Crystal Palace are in court today to try and stop suspended manager Steve Bruce from leaving for promotion rivals Birmingham City.

Despite a possible 9 month notice that Bruce might have to serve on his current contract with Palace, Birmingham are prepared to wait for their man, and let Bruce choose a caretaker manager to take control of team affairs.

The obvious candidate for the caretaker role would be Mark Bowen, who has already told Simon Jordan of his intensions to jump ship to Birmingham City, to become Bruce's assistant manager.
